PHP Forum

PHP Forum (http://www.selfphp.de/forum/index.php)
-   MySQLi/PDO/(MySQL) (http://www.selfphp.de/forum/forumdisplay.php?f=22)
-   -   Nur ein Datensatz anzeigen ohne Schleife (http://www.selfphp.de/forum/showthread.php?t=7906)

Small-Talk 08.06.2004 14:23:46

Nur ein Datensatz anzeigen ohne Schleife
 
Hi ich bins schon wieder. Möochte nur einen bestimmten Datensatz anzeigen, bei dem ich auch die id weiß:

Abfrage:
PHP-Code:

$abfrage mysql_query("SELECT * FROM s_deejays WHERE  `id` = '".dj_id."' LIMIT 1"); 

anzeigen:
PHP-Code:

echo mysql_result($abfrage,0,"s_deejays.datumn"

Nur bekomme ich da immer angezeigt:
Warning: mysql_result(): Unable to jump to row 0 on MySQL result index 6 in /home/www/kunden/elektro-tanz.de/service/deejays_anzeige.php on line 26

Wenn ich die 0 mit der 1 austausche das gleiche mit 1

Hatte es vorher in einer For schleife drin, wo bei der abfrage alle datensätze gelesen werden in mit for die der angezeigt wird, wo die id übereinstimmt.

Das finde ich allerdings sehr recourcen verbrauchend und wollte es jetzt schon bei der abfrage tun, dass er nicht alle datensaätze lesen muß.

Bitte um Hilfe

bazubi 08.06.2004 14:26:56

PHP-Code:

$query = @mysql_query("SELECT * FROM tabelle WHERE id = 'wasauchimmer'");

$daten = @mysql_fetch_assoc($query);

echo 
$daten['feld1'];
echo 
$daten['feld2']; 


Small-Talk 08.06.2004 14:41:03

danke für die schnelle Antwort funktioniert super.

Merke sogar gleich, dass es schneller geht (-:


ThanXs


Alle Zeitangaben in WEZ +2. Es ist jetzt 21:06:02 Uhr.

Powered by vBulletin® Version 3.8.3 (Deutsch)
Copyright ©2000 - 2024, Jelsoft Enterprises Ltd.